What is the Alaska Commodity Supplemental Food Program Application?

The Alaska Commodity Supplemental Food Program (CSFP) is a vital initiative designed to assist individuals aged 60 or older in accessing essential food resources. This program addresses food insecurity by providing nutritional support through a simple application process.
The application form plays a crucial role in connecting eligible seniors to food assistance. It enables the identification of those who need help and ensures they receive adequate support for maintaining a healthy diet.

Purpose and Benefits of the Alaska CSFP Application

The Alaska CSFP Application is necessary for several reasons, primarily ensuring that qualified individuals benefit from this crucial food assistance program. It serves to streamline eligibility determination and facilitate access to nutritious food for seniors.
Participants in the program enjoy access to healthy food options, which is vital for their overall well-being. Those eligible for assistance must adhere to specific income guidelines to qualify for this nutritional support.

Eligibility Criteria for the Alaska Commodity Supplemental Food Program Application

To qualify for the CSFP, applicants must meet several eligibility criteria. These criteria primarily revolve around income levels, taking into account household size and other relevant factors.
Additionally, applicants must be residents of Alaska and aged 60 or older. Accurate documentation is essential for verifying eligibility and ensuring that applicants receive the assistance they need.
